use crate::error::Error;
use std::fs;
use std::io::prelude::*;
use std::path::{Path, PathBuf};
use std::process::{Command, Stdio};
pub struct FS;
impl FS {
pub fn new() -> Self {
Self {}
}
pub fn create_dir(&self, path: &str) -> Result<(), Error> {
if !Path::new(path).exists() {
return fs::create_dir_all(path)
.map_err(|e| Error::FS(format!("Cannot create directory '{path}' ({e})")));
}
Result::Ok(())
}
pub fn copy_dir(&self, from: &str, to: &str) -> Result<(), Error> {
Command::new("cp")
.arg("--recursive")
.arg(from)
.arg(to)
.stdout(Stdio::null())
.stderr(Stdio::null())
.spawn()
.map_err(Error::Io)?
.wait()
.map(|_| ())
.map_err(|e| {
Error::FS(format!(
"Cannot copy directory from '{from}' to '{to}' ({e})"
))
})
}
pub fn read_dir(&self, path: &str) -> Result<fs::ReadDir, Error> {
fs::read_dir(path).map_err(|e| Error::FS(format!("Cannot read directory '{path}' ({e})")))
}
pub fn read_dir_file_paths(&self, path: &str) -> Result<Vec<PathBuf>, Error> {
self.read_dir(path)
.map(|dir| dir.flatten().map(|dir| dir.path()).collect())
}
pub fn remove_dir(&self, path: &str) -> Result<(), Error> {
fs::remove_dir_all(path)
.map_err(|e| Error::FS(format!("Cannot remove directory '{path}' ({e})")))
}
pub fn setup_directory_access(&self, path: &str) -> Result<(), Error> {
self.create_dir(path)?;
let permission = fs::metadata(path)
.map_err(|e| Error::FS(format!("Cannot read directory metadata '{path}' ({e})")))?
.permissions();
if permission.readonly() {
return Err(Error::FS(format!("Cannot write directory '{path}'")));
}
Result::Ok(())
}
pub fn create_file(&self, path: &str) -> Result<fs::File, Error> {
std::fs::OpenOptions::new()
.write(true)
.create(true)
.truncate(true)
.open(path)
.map_err(|e| Error::FS(format!("Cannot create file '{path}' ({e})")))
}
pub fn open_file(&self, path: &str) -> Result<fs::File, Error> {
fs::File::open(path).map_err(|e| Error::FS(format!("Cannot open file '{path}' ({e})")))
}
pub fn path_exists(&self, path: &str) -> bool {
Path::new(path).exists()
}
pub fn write_file(&self, path: &str, data: &[u8]) -> Result<(), Error> {
self.create_file(path)?
.write_all(data)
.map_err(|e| Error::FS(format!("Cannot write file '{path}' ({e})")))
}
pub fn read_file_to_string(&self, path: &str) -> Result<String, Error> {
fs::read_to_string(path).map_err(|e| Error::FS(format!("Cannot read file '{path}' ({e})")))
}
pub fn rename_file(&self, from: &str, to: &str) -> Result<(), Error> {
fs::rename(from, to)
.map_err(|e| Error::FS(format!("Cannot rename file from '{from}' to '{to}' ({e})")))
}
pub fn remove_file(&self, path: &str) -> Result<(), Error> {
fs::remove_file(path).map_err(|e| Error::FS(format!("Cannot delete file '{path}' ({e})")))
}
}
